Test drove one today and although it’s better in the flesh than in the photos, the drive was well.....a bit bland. Don’t get me wrong, if you’ve never driven a powerful car then it will blow your socks off but having had E92 M3’s, F-type R’s and currently a stage 3 E89 35iS, it was a bit tame.
Great road holding, compliant and comfortable but the noise in the cabin did not translate when you opened the window expecting a howl and pops and burbles BUT.....bland.
I walked away saying to my wife that for £54k, I could have a great 2nd hand M4 - so that’s what I bought! A bonkers competition model with noise and road presence with no sign of Mr.Bland whatsoever.
